HIGH PURITY 4,4-ISOPROPYLIDENE-BIS-(2,6 DIBROMOPHENOL) AND PROCESS FOR THE PREPARATION OF SUCH HIGH PURITY 4,4-ISOPROPYLIDENE-BIS-(2,6 DIBROMOPHENOL)

A high purity 4-4'-isopropylidine-(2,6-di-bromophenol) characterized by ionic impurities less than 10 ppm, colour in alkaline solution from 60-100 HU, HPLC purity about 99.9 %, APHA of 20 % MeOH solution less than 10.00 HU, Fe less than 1.0 ppm, turbidity of 20 % MeOH solution less than 5.0 HU, pH of 10 % slurry 6.0-7.0, average particle size of 250-280 nm and angle of repose equal to or less than 35°. The product is produced by reacting Bisphenol-A with bromine in a 'water-immiscible' polar solvent in the presence of hydrogen peroxide, aging the reaction products after the reaction, eliminating the excess bromine by reducing agents, washing the product layer with a combination of anionic surfactant, alkali, reducing agent and demineralised water under controlled pH conditions, partially distilling the organic solvent chilling the medium containing the product, filtering the crude product, boiling the crude product with alkali, reducing agent and demineralised water, filtering the TBBA, washing the product with demineralised water and drying to obtain the final high purity TBBA with high yield.
